A mid 18th Century Oak Chest Of Drawers of small proportions with red Walnut cross banding to the drawer fronts, top and brushing slide. It is fabulous rich warm colour and patina and in very good original order. The chest has wonderful original pierced brass handles and escutcheons, the feet are for the most part original. The original pine drawer linings are nice and clean, the back boards are original and made in pine although they have been papered over many years ago.
